Embodiment 1

[0035] The maintenance method for joint reinforcement in this embodiment comprises the following steps:

[0036] Step 1, such as figure 2 As shown, a notch 6 is made at the position of the hinge joint 2; specifically, at the top of the hinge joint 2; when opening the notch 6, part of the structure of the bridge is chiseled at the position of the hinge joint 2 until the reinforcement structure is exposed. Specifically, in this embodiment, the asphalt pavement 3 and part of the concrete pavement 4 of the bridge are chiseled at the hinge joint 2 until the steel mesh 5 in the concrete pavement 4 is exposed, that is, the concrete pavement is chiseled out. Concrete above the reinforcement mesh sheet 5 in layer 4 until the reinforcement mesh sheet 5 is exposed.

Abstract

The invention discloses a hinge joint reinforcing and maintaining method and a reinforcing and maintaining device. The hinge joint reinforcing and maintaining method comprises the following steps that1, forming a notch in the position of a hinge joint; 2, drilling a vertical through hole in the hinge joint; 3, arranging an upper anchoring plate at the notch, a lower anchoring plate is arranged atthe position, corresponding to the notch, below the plate beam, arranging a counter pull rod between the upper anchoring plate and the lower anchoring plate, the counter pull rod penetrates through the upper anchoring plate and the lower anchoring plate and is arranged in the vertical through hole, and then fastening the counter pull rod, the upper anchoring plate and the lower anchoring plate; 4, repairing the notch; 5, sealing the bottom of the hinge joint; and 6, injecting glue. The reinforcing maintenance device is additionally arranged, so that the transverse connection between the platebeams is enhanced, the stress state of the single beam is weakened, the vibration of the beam plate is avoided, and the cracking and discretization of the crack repairing adhesive are avoided.

technical field [0001] The invention relates to a hinge joint reinforcement maintenance method and a reinforcement maintenance device. Background technique [0002] Such as figure 1 As shown, bridges or viaducts are often formed by connecting multiple plate girders, and each plate girder forms a transverse force connection through hinge joints, so that each plate girder forms a stressed whole. [0003] Damage to the hinged joints of the slab girder will cause damage to the slab. To repair the hinged joints, at this stage, the method of injecting glue or grouting into the hinged joints is mainly used to reinforce and repair the hinged joints. However, the injected colloid will crack and discretize, which will cause the loss of the glue injection effect; and the injection of colloid into the hinged seam will make the hinged seam unable to be repaired again.
